Discussion on the Basic Principles for Health and Medical Data Sharing

Zhang Jiannan, Li Yingying, Gu Yanju, Zhu Yelin, He Qianfeng

Strategic Study of CAE 2020, Volume 22, Issue 4,   Pages 93-100 doi: 10.15302/J-SSCAE-2020.04.012

Abstract:

Health and medical data sharing in China is in its infancy.Key issues such as privacy security, unclear data ownership, and unclear distribution of benefits havelong hindered the health and medical data sharing in China.Basic principles for the sharing can guide and promote the health and medical data sharing and help realizethe values of these data.
